Transaction 843df5167363d6e465c0581335fc145131dd63a172deb25fd8f26b0823f7c5cf
2 Input
2 Outputs
- 843df5167363d6e465c0581335fc145131dd63a172deb25fd8f26b0823f7c5cf:0
- 843df5167363d6e465c0581335fc145131dd63a172deb25fd8f26b0823f7c5cf:1
value 1625309
address 17WmomPzWoGb5BdnvefvLh1eZY6NhyQAHk
value 5000000
address 3NtjWTviGmokGstfyYXgCN82jWnuqpRTiX